formatting = {
format = function(entry, vim_item)
vim_item.kind = string.format('%s %s', kind_icons[vim_item.kind], vim_item.kind) -- This concatenates the icons with the name of the item kind
vim_item.menu = ({
buffer = '[Buffer]',
nvim_lsp = '[LSP]',
luasnip = '[LuaSnip]',
nvim_lua = '[Lua]',
latex_symbols = '[LaTeX]',
})[entry.source.name]
return vim_item
end,
expandable_indicator = true,
fields = { 'abbr', 'kind', 'menu' },
},
window = {
completion = cmp.config.window.bordered({
winhighlight = 'Normal:Normal,FloatBorder:WinSeparator,CursorLine:Visual,Search:None',
}),
documentation = cmp.config.window.bordered({
winhighlight = 'Normal:Normal,FloatBorder:WinSeparator,CursorLine:Visual,Search:None',
}),
},
